RAGNAR Wasatch Back (194 Miles) 30:05:11, Place in age division: 48 | Running Miles | Swimming Yards | Bike Miles | 13.00 | 0.00 | 0.00 |
| A few years ago I wouldn't have imagined typing this next line - I had a really fun time running the RAGNAR relay over the past two days.
Our team was running to promote organ donation awareness. Thus, no kills recorded. Van 1 was a group of surgeons and hepatologists from the Mayo Clinic. Van 2 was an an ecclectic bunch from Intermountain Healthcare, Kansas University, PRA Health Sciences, and BD Medical (our ringer).
We drove up to Eden and spent Friday morning playing basketball at a cabin owned by a teammate's family in Eden. Once the temperature finally started pushing 100 degrees, we were off...
Friday 6:45pm - Leg 9 - 7.6 miles up the old Snowbasin road in 55:17 (7:15 pace). This was a solid climb (+1500 net gain) with beautiful views looking back down over the Pineview Reservoir.

Friday 8:30pm - Leg 10 - 3 miles down the Trapper's Loop road (5:30 pace). A mid-run asthma flare-up caused one of our teammates to abandon her leg... luckily I hadn't taken my shoes off yet and was able to jump in. Too downhill for my tastes (-750 feet!)
Attempted to sleep for a few hours... maybe got 20 minutes worth.
Saturday 4:30am - Leg 20 - 2.7 miles starting in Hoytsville (6:25 pace). It was very dark. The run was relatively flat.
Fortunately one of our teammates lives in Park City, so were were able to hang out (shower!!) at her house for the morning while the Mayo van was on the course.
Saturday High Noon - Leg 31 (the Ragnarliest leg ever, +2200 net gain) - 10 miles from Park City to Empire Pass and then towards Guardsman Pass for the exchange in 1:21:15 (8:10 pace). Aerobically I was never really stressed, but I am still lacking the muscular power to hammer a climb like this (although that seems to be coming around). I kept it at a moderately hard effort that wouldn't test my hamstring too much and had fun with it. Honestly I felt bad for almost everyone else that had to run this leg, I bet it took a lot of people 3-4 hours.

Now that I've finally done a RAGNAR, I'd say that like a lot of things in life, how much you enjoy it comes down to who you are with. We had a fantastic group - nothing but good times for two days. Thank god for 15 passenger vans, finishing an hour under the projected time, and a beer tent at the end.
